What You’ll Need
- TrustPure Cold Brew Coffee (coarsely ground)
- A large jar or pitcher
- A fine mesh strainer or cheesecloth
- Cold or room-temperature filtered water
Basic Cold Brew Recipe
- Measure: Use a 1:4 ratio — 1 cup of coarsely ground coffee to 4 cups of cold water (adjust to taste)
- Combine: Add coffee grounds to your jar, pour water over them, and stir gently
- Steep: Cover and refrigerate for 12–24 hours (longer = stronger)
- Strain: Pour through a fine mesh strainer or cheesecloth into a clean container
- Serve: Dilute with water or milk to taste, pour over ice, and enjoy!
Tips for the Best Cold Brew
- Use coarse grounds to avoid a bitter, over-extracted brew
- Filtered water makes a noticeable difference in flavor
- Cold brew concentrate keeps in the fridge for up to 2 weeks
